Mike Stone Division Director of Parks and Recreation |
Mike Stone manages a budget of $17 million and a staff of over 85 that balloons to 400 during the busy summer parksand recreation season. With over 55 developed parks and more than 3,600 acres, the Spokane Parks and Recreation Department is a wonderful asset to this community. Among many other things, Mike's team ensures that Riverfront Park's carrousel is running, the golf greens on our four City courses are impeccable, our swimming pools are clean, our turf and formal gardens are manicured and our urban forestry is healthy. Background: Mike was named the City’s Parks and Recreation Director in November 2001. With over 25 years at Parks and Recreation, Mike brings a wealth of knowledge and experience to this position. Since becoming the Director, Mike has ensured that the Spokane Parks and Recreation Department has continued to grow and develop to meet the changing needs of the community, while maintaining the 100-year legacy of an outstanding park system. Mike has a bachelor’s of landscape architecture degree from the University of Idaho and masters of organizational leadership degree from Gonzaga University. He is a certified Park and Recreation Professional, a licensed landscape architect, and is a member of NRPA, WRPA, ASLA, NGF and former board member of the National Institute of Golf Management. |
